Govt Medical Admission Fees in Bangladesh
The govt medical admission fees in Bangladesh vary depending on the institution, student category, and government regulations. However, government medical colleges are generally more affordable compared to private institutions.
For local students, fees are heavily subsidised by the government, making medical education accessible to a large population. For foreign students, including Indian students, the fees are slightly higher but still affordable compared to other countries.
Average Fee Structure Overview
Government MBBS fees in Bangladesh include tuition fees, admission charges, hostel fees, and other miscellaneous expenses. While tuition fees remain low, hostel and living expenses may vary depending on location and facilities.
Fee Structure Table
| Category | Approx Fees |
|---|---|
| Tuition Fees | INR 8–15 Lakhs |
| Admission Fees | INR 1–2 Lakhs |
| Hostel Fees | INR 3–5 Lakhs |
| Total Estimated Cost | INR 12–22 Lakhs |

Eligibility Criteria for MBBS Admission in Bangladesh
Students must fulfil certain eligibility requirements to apply for MBBS in government medical colleges in Bangladesh.
- Academic Requirements
Students must have completed 10+2 education with Physics, Chemistry, and Biology as main subjects.
- Minimum Marks Criteria
Most colleges require a minimum percentage in PCB subjects to ensure academic readiness.
- Age Requirement
The minimum age requirement is 17 years at the time of admission.
- NEET Requirement (For Indian Students)
Indian students must qualify NEET to apply for MBBS in Bangladesh.

Direct Admission in MBBS in Bangladesh
Many students search for direct admission in MBBS in Bangladesh. In reality, admission is based on eligibility criteria and document verification. There is no completely “direct admission” without fulfilling academic and regulatory requirements.
Foreign students must still apply through proper channels and meet eligibility conditions.

Cost of Living for MBBS Students in Bangladesh
Apart from tuition fees, students must also consider living expenses.
Monthly Living Cost Table
| Expense | Monthly Cost |
|---|---|
| Hostel | INR 5,000–10,000 |
| Food | INR 4,000–8,000 |
| Transport | INR 1,000–3,000 |
| Miscellaneous | INR 1,000–2,000 |
